Ubuntu已经安装glibc 2.31版本 怎么降级到2.27
时间: 2024-01-23 15:01:45 浏览: 31
在Ubuntu中降级glibc是一个非常危险的操作,因为glibc是操作系统的核心组件之一,更改版本可能会导致系统不稳定或无法启动。所以,我建议你最好不要降级glibc。
如果你已经决定要降级glibc,你需要执行以下步骤:
1. 下载glibc 2.27的源代码包,可以从官网下载:https://ftp.gnu.org/gnu/glibc/glibc-2.27.tar.gz
2. 解压源代码包,进入解压后的目录。
3. 编译并安装glibc 2.27,可以使用以下命令:
```
mkdir build
cd build
../configure --prefix=/usr/local/glibc-2.27
make
sudo make install
```
这个命令会将glibc 2.27安装到`/usr/local/glibc-2.27`目录下。
4. 设置LD_LIBRARY_PATH环境变量,以便系统能够找到新安装的glibc。可以使用以下命令:
```
export LD_LIBRARY_PATH=/usr/local/glibc-2.27/lib:$LD_LIBRARY_PATH
```
注意,这个命令只会在当前终端窗口中设置LD_LIBRARY_PATH环境变量,如果需要永久生效,需要将这个命令添加到`~/.bashrc`文件中。
5. 测试新安装的glibc是否能够正常工作。可以使用以下命令:
```
/usr/local/glibc-2.27/lib/ld-2.27.so /bin/ls
```
这个命令会使用glibc 2.27运行`ls`命令,如果能够正常工作,说明glibc 2.27已经安装并运行成功。
注意,降级glibc可能会导致系统不稳定或无法启动,所以建议你在使用前先备份系统数据和配置文件。如果出现问题,可以尝试使用恢复模式或重新安装Ubuntu系统。